IN THE UNITED STATES DISTRICT COURT WESTERN DISTRICT OF ARKANSAS HARRISON DIVISION DENA INEZ PENCE v. PLAINTIFF CIVIL NO. 12-3166 MICHAEL J. ASTRUE, Commissioner Social Security Administration DEFENDANT ORDER Plaintiff has submitted a complaint for filing in this district, together with a request for leave to proceed in forma pauperis. ECF Nos. 1, 2. The undersigned finds that more information is needed to rule on Plaintiff’s IFP application. The application indicates that Plaintiff’s spouse works, but does not provide the Court with any information regarding his income. Without this information, the Court cannot rule on Plaintiff’s application. Accordingly, Plaintiff is directed to file an amended application indicating the income of her spouse on or before January 11, 2013. Should Plaintiff fail to comply within the required period of time, her complaint will become subject to summary dismissal for failure to obey a court order.
